摘要: ...................... 阅读全文
posted @ 2019-02-06 17:13 floatingcloak 阅读(826) 评论(0) 推荐(0) 编辑
摘要: 高精度的一些模板 阅读全文
posted @ 2019-01-31 11:39 floatingcloak 阅读(175) 评论(0) 推荐(0) 编辑
摘要: 贪心+结构体 阅读全文
posted @ 2019-01-30 11:31 floatingcloak 阅读(110) 评论(0) 推荐(0) 编辑
摘要: 说明: 1.模板中maxn表示最大数据规模,可以用 定义,其中数为数值 2.对于含有模板的模板,用类似于STL中的map,bitset的方法定义 数学模块 扩展欧几里得算法 说明:用于计算方程 其中 的一组解 乘法逆元 说明:求a的模m乘法逆元(),其中a,m互质;如果返回值为-1说明无解,建议用参 阅读全文
posted @ 2018-10-08 20:21 floatingcloak 阅读(398) 评论(0) 推荐(0) 编辑
摘要: 1.-wall-wall 可以在编译时显示最多警告信息,帮助大家查错打开方式:工具 --> 编译选项 --> 代码生成优化 --> 代码警告 --> 显示最多警告信息 --> 改为Yes2.防止爆栈在考试时,我们常常要对拍,如果dfs层数太多会爆栈,所以这个时候我们需... 阅读全文
posted @ 2018-09-29 17:25 floatingcloak 阅读(513) 评论(0) 推荐(0) 编辑
摘要: 目录图的类型与性质 1.1 欧拉图 1.2 哈密尔顿图拓扑排序最短路 3.1 Dijkstra 3.1.1 优先队列优化 3.1.2 堆优化 3.1.3 路径还原 3.2 Bellman-Ford 3.2.1 ... 阅读全文
posted @ 2018-09-10 20:28 floatingcloak 阅读(642) 评论(0) 推荐(0) 编辑
摘要: 目录STL中数据结构通用操作 1.1二分查找 1.2排列生成栈 2.1单调栈队列 3.1优先队列 3.2单调队列向量链表 5.1链式前向星 5.2舞蹈链(dancing links)堆 6.... 阅读全文
posted @ 2018-09-05 22:53 floatingcloak 阅读(494) 评论(1) 推荐(0) 编辑
摘要: 目录排列1.1不可重排列1.2可重排列1.3圆排列1.4不尽相异元素全排列1.5多重集的排列组合2.1不可重组合数2.2可重组合2.3不相邻组合2.4多重集的组合2.5常用组合数公式2.6组合数取模(模板)常用公式及定理3.1二项式定理3.2鸽巢原理3.3常... 阅读全文
posted @ 2018-08-31 14:24 floatingcloak 阅读(2189) 评论(0) 推荐(1) 编辑
摘要: 目录:整除的性质常见定理模与余3.1模运算3.2同余的性质3.3快速幂数论重要定理及应用4.1欧几里得定理4.2扩展欧几里得4.3线性同余方程(模线性方程)4.4中国剩余定理(模线性方程组)4.5乘法逆元4.6二次同余方程4.7唯一分解定理素数及其相关定理5... 阅读全文
posted @ 2018-08-30 23:51 floatingcloak 阅读(1156) 评论(0) 推荐(3) 编辑
摘要: 常用博弈论模板,代码大部分摘自网络,个人整理总结,不定期更新 巴什博弈: 只有一堆n个物品,两个人轮流从中取物,规定每次最少取一个,最多取m个,最后取光者为胜 若 n%(m+1)==0 后手必胜 否则先手必胜,若n>m,第一次取n%(m+1)个,若n<=m,则第一次可取n~m间任意个 威佐夫博弈: 阅读全文
posted @ 2018-08-29 20:16 floatingcloak 阅读(297) 评论(0) 推荐(0) 编辑